Data Structures and Algorithms: Efficiency in Action

In the realm within computer science, data structures and algorithms are fundamental building blocks that power software efficiency. Computational methods provide a structured approach to solving problems, while data structures act as mechanisms for optimally storing and retrieving information. A strategic data structure can materially impact the execution time of an algorithm, making a substantial difference in runtime complexity.

  • Think about a case where you need to find a unique element within a large dataset of data. A sorted array would permit a efficient lookup, resulting in logarithmic time complexity, as opposed to a sequential scan that exhibits linear time complexity.
  • Similarly, a chain of nodes can provide benefits for adding and removing items.

Cybersecurity Essentials: Protecting Your Digital World

In today's interconnected world, cybersecurity has become paramount. Our digital lives are increasingly entwined with our physical existences. From sensitive data to financial operations, we entrust a vast amount of information to the digital sphere.

Therefore, it is essential to implement robust cybersecurity measures to protect our security. This demands a multi-faceted approach that encompasses awareness, sound habits, and the implementation of appropriate technologies.

A solid cybersecurity foundation includes:

* Robust Passwords: Employ difficult-to-guess passwords for all your logins and avoid sharing them across multiple platforms.

* Multi-Factor Authentication (MFA): Utilize MFA wherever possible to add an extra shield of protection by requiring additional verification beyond your password.

* Regular Software Updates: Keep your operating system, applications, and gadgets up to date with the latest patches to resolve known exploits.

* Phishing Awareness: Be cautious of suspicious communications and avoid clicking on dubious links or attachments. Verify the originator's identity before providing any confidential information.

By adhering to these cybersecurity essentials, you can bolster your defenses and minimize the risk of falling victim to cyber threats. Remember that staying informed and practicing good security habits are crucial for protecting your digital world.
